Yeah, I think no matter what your car is gonna rattle somewhere if you have the volume up high...unless you carpet all of your panels like WhiteRabbit did. Even time I find a rattle and fix it another one seems to pop up (or atleast I notice a new one)! For instance this morning I noticed my right back seat passenger's panel was rattling like hell and it pissed me off!
Anywayz, Dynamat is kinda pricey...maybe look into fatmat (fatmat.com). Almost as good as Dynamat Extreme, and for half the price. I actually have some of both in my car, and i regret buying the Dynamat because of the price. Do it yourself too...it is easy! I also got a cheap lil roller to put it on with, and that made it easier (worth the 6 bucks IMO).

you should inspect your trunk for loose bolts and screws, cuz that can cause rattling too, dynamat and fatmat is going to help a little of the rattling is not going to get rid of it
